Pre-monsoon showers bring relief to Lucknow; IMD warns of heavy rain in 13 UP districts
Clouds hovered over Lucknow on Tuesday morning, accompanied by cool easterly winds. The day is expected to see intermittent sunshine and light showers. According to weather reports, active weather systems over the Arabian Sea and Bay of Bengal are expected to intensify monsoon conditions in Uttar Pradesh within 2–3 days. Following which, Meteorological Department has issued a warning for heavy rainfall on 18 and 19.
Widespread rain and gusty winds across UP
Meanwhile, strong winds of 40–50 km/h are expected today across many UP districts. The Met Department reported light to moderate rainfall with thunderstorms in 51–75% of western UP and 26–50% of eastern UP. Notable rainfall included:
Bareilly: 149.4 mm
Nakur (Saharanpur): 120 mm
Bijnor: 86 mm
Mankapur (Gonda): 83 mm
Shardanagar (Lakhimpur Kheri): 66.4 mm
Lightning alert issued for 13 districts
Lighting warning has been issued in Sonbhadra, Mirzapur, Chandauli, Deoria, Gorakhpur, Sant Kabir Nagar, Basti, Kushinagar, Siddharthnagar, Gonda, Balrampur, Shravasti, and Bahraich.
The rainfall has come as a boon for paddy and sugarcane farmers, allowing sowing to begin without irrigation. However, there are concerns that excessive moisture may harm mango, jamun and vegetable crops.
Steady drop in temperature over three days
The maximum temperature will hover around 35°C today. As per reports, mercury has dropped significantly in the last three days. On Monday, the maximum temperature stood at 35.7°C, 2.3°C below normal. Sunday recorded 39.9°C, and Saturday a sweltering 42.6°C.
